Working in Politically Sensitive Countries With Limited Resources Stymied Monitoring and Evaluation Efforts of Selected Middle East Missions
Recommendations
USAID/Egypt implement additional controls to make sure required data quality assessments are completed before submitting data in the annual performance plan and report.
USAID/Egypt, in coordination with its technical offices, implement a plan to strengthen controls over its databases to reduce errors in reporting.
USAID/Egypt conduct an assessment with mission employees to find ways of improving Egypt Info for performance monitoring and reporting, and document an action plan with milestones to address the assessment's findings.
USAID/Jordan, in coordination with its technical offices, implement a plan to strengthen controls over its databases to reduce errors in reporting.
USAID/Jordan implement procedures to assess what agreement officer's representatives, contracting officer's representatives, and office directors need before the mission develops a new information management system for performance monitoring.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za document an assessment and decision whether to hire an outside firm or other alternative to provide technical assistance for local nongovernmental organizations on USAID's requirements.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za conduct an assessment with its staff and implementers to find ways of improving the Geo-Management Information System for performance monitoring and reporting, and document an action plan with timelines to address the assessment's findings.
USAID/Egypt develop a mission-wide performance management plan.
USAID/Jordan implement an action plan to make sure all activity and project performance management plan indicators feed into the mission performance management plan.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za develop a mission-wide performance management plan.
USAID/Egypt implement an action plan to make sure gender-sensitive indicators and sex-disaggregated data are incorporated in project design documents and activity performance management plans.
USAID/Jordan implement additional controls to make sure required data quality assessments are completed before submitting data in the annual performance plan and report.
USAID/Jordan implement an action plan to make sure sex-disaggregated data are incorporated in activity performance management plans.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za implement an action plan to make sure sex-disaggregated data are incorporated in activity performance management plans.
USAID/Egypt document the reallocation of budgeted funds to make sure enough money is dedicated to monitoring and evaluations.
USAID/Jordan document the reallocation of budgeted funds to make sure enough money is dedicated to monitoring and evaluations.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za document the reallocation of budgeted funds to make sure enough money is dedicated to monitoring and evaluations.
USAID/West Bank and Gaza implement changes to its budgeting process to make sure the monitoring and evaluation point of contact has input on how monitoring and evaluation funds are allocated.
USAID/Egypt implement additional tools (e.g., templates, standardized filing systems, handover checklists) that management deems appropriate for agreement officer's representatives and contracting officer's representatives to use when documenting and maintaining official files.
USAID/Egypt's contracting and agreement office implement a plan to work with agreement officer's representatives and contracting officer's representatives to reinforce requirements for documenting site visit reports and maintaining official files.
